## v3.8.0 — Changed defaults

The GateTally turnstile counter now debounces pulses at 150 ms instead of 80 ms, after double-count incidents at the Harrowfield Arena rollout. Offline buffering is also enabled by default, so brief network drops at the gates no longer lose counts. Upgrading installs inherit these defaults unless overridden. For reference, the service now ships with the following configuration.

settings of yageg-yahap:
[gorael]
team = olieth
access_code = ac_941d74
owner = brieth.aldiel
host = gorael.tolvaqio.internal
port = 6379
peer = briwyn.urlaqtech.internal
salt = 116e6622
pin = 1957

# LedgerLens audit-log viewer — environment config for support staff. This file controls which tenant logs you can see and how far back queries may reach. Keep `LL_RETENTION_DAYS` at 90 unless the compliance desk at Harrowgate says otherwise, and never enable `LL_RAW_EXPORT` in shared sessions. Changes take effect after restarting the viewer service. The viewer needs to authenticate against the Brindlecote log store, and its access credential is set on the following line.

sealed setting: RELAY_SECRET5=82864

## Hot-Reloading Configuration — Quillbrook Data Stores

The Quillbrook config daemon watches the settings table and pushes changes to running services without a restart. When editing values, commit through the Lanterly admin panel rather than raw SQL, since the daemon relies on the panel's change-journal triggers. Reloads settle within thirty seconds; if a service misses a cycle, it falls back to its last snapshot. To verify reload behaviour in staging, you will need read access to the config store. Connect using the string below.

primary connection of tajeg-tajop = postgresql://julax_svc:DI@db-e7f3.kelvidyn.corp:5432/rusdor

Welcome to the ParityPeak on-call rotation. The rate-parity checker crawls partner hotel listings hourly and flags price mismatches. Most pages come from stale crawler sessions — restart the worker pool before anything else, and note the timestamp for the audit log. The full triage procedure is documented on the internal wiki page here:

runbook for badug-kadup: https://confluence.zemvarlabs.internal/projects/browse/display/projects/bd1b